    Volunteer Abroad in Rural France. This is an opportunity for anyone who wants a break with a difference! Make new friends, keep fit, learn about French culture and cuisine, art and history, whilst renovating a cottage and garden.

    Richard is looking for volunteers to come to France to help renovate a 15th century complex that is an arts residency and its garden in a medieval village in the heart of the Auvergne. Comfortable guest rooms are available, and hot evening meals will be supplied in return for a very basic contribution toward costs.

    We will be working amongst the most beautiful landscape, within a Medieval village, surrounded by a Gorge, Benedictine Abbey, Forests, Volcanoes and castles!

  • Arthouse Chantelle's Mission Statement

    Arthouse is a small gallery, studio, workshop, arts residency and home in the rural town of Chantelle in central france. Housed in a 15th century building, it sits on the edge of a beautiful wooded river gorge. Local architecture is largely medieval with the Abbey of St Vincent nearby in the town and dominating the Gorge. Typically, work involves basic skills - gardening, walling, painting etc. but craftsmen are valued as well!
